Due to public concerns about transgenic organisms, it is necessary to establish valid protocols for constructing vectors with safety and expression efficiency.In present study, follistain (FST) gene expression vectors with either only bicistron gene transfer body or a MAR carried-bicistron gene transfer body were constructed and respectively transfected to bovine fetal fibroblasts.
